Prof. Dr. Ulrich Hofmann
Neurologist, Freiburg, Germany
Senior Consultant, 24 years of experience , , Freiburg University Hospital, Freiburg Highlights
- Prof. Dr. Ulrich Hofmann is a Neurologist based in Freiburg with over 24+ years of experience.
- His academic career started with studies in applied physics at the TU München in 1987 where he received his Ph.D. in 1996 in (bio) physics with work on bio-hybrid semiconductor sensors and ultra-thin layers.
- In 1998, he undertook post-doctoral research at the Åbo Akademi in Turku, Finland, and at the California Institute of Technology, Pasadena, CA as a Feodor-Lynen-Fellow.
- Since 2012, he is heading the department for Neuroelectronic Systems of the University Medical Center Freiburg as endowed Peter-Osypka-Professor.
- In 2015, he was honored by the FRIAS-USIAS fellowship at the University of Rhode Island as a "Distinguished International Scholar“.
- Dr. Hofmann has special interests Electrophysiology: In vitro Patch-Clamp & MEA In vivo multi-channel recordings, Immuno-histology, Behavioural experiments with rodents: Real and VR mazes, etc.
- He is currently the co-editor for "Frontiers in Neuroscience: Section Neural Technology“, and co-edited "Cognitive Neurodynamics“ for seven years and acts as a reviewer for numerous journals and funding agencies.
- His mentoring includes more than 60 master thesis, 16 Ph.D. thesis, and 4 startup companies.

Prof. Dr. med. Gabriele Schackert
Neurosurgeon, Dresden, Germany
Director, 32 years of experience , , Carl Gustav Carus University Hospital, Dresden Highlights
- With 32+ years of experience, Prof. Dr. med. Gabriele Schackert is a neurosurgeon with a worldwide reputation.
- Her clinical interest includes tumor surgery, skull base surgery, acoustic neuromas, intramedullary tumors, gliomas, molecular analysis of brain tumors and aneurysms.
- She is a member of the German Society for Neurosurgery (DGNC), German Society for Neuro-Oncology, European Association of Neurological Oncology (EANO), German Academy for Neurosurgery, European Skull Base Society (ESB), German Society for Basic Skull Surgery, German Academy for Education and Training in Neurosurgery and German Research Foundation.
- Prof. Schackert has been elected as speaker of Cancer Society, Neuro-Oncology Section.
- She is a co-editor of the Central Journal for Neurosurgery.
- She has been 2nd Chairperson of the Standing Commission for Science and Research.
